Type-A
Most cables have type-A connectors at one end. That’s because most of the peripherals like keyboards, mice, etc. demand type-A connections. Power adapters for most of your mobile devices today also have the same connector. So, whatever cable you select, you are mostly looking for type-A at one end.
Type-B & Mini USB
Type-B USB cables are (almost) square shaped connectors, mostly required to connect printers and other powered devices to your computer. They are very rarely used and do not normally connect to phones and laptops.
Another type is the Mini USB which is on the brink of extinction except for use in some of the Camera devices. So, let’s postpone the discussion about these for some time later.
MicroUSB
Micro-USB is the standard form of connection for most phone and other devices these days. But it isn’t the future. It is eventually disappearing with the introduction of advanced technologies in the market. In the near future, Type-C USB Cable is supposed to take its place.
Type-C USB
Many of the newly launched phones, tablets, laptops, and gaming consoles are now coming with the Type-C USB connectors. It can be a little uneconomical and cumbersome to change all your cables but let’s see why it’s worth it.
USB-C cables are reversible and can charge your devices much faster than the Micro cables ever did. Another important use of USB connections is data transfer. These cables have a much faster data transfer rate than the extensively available options today.
But even these can be brutal for your devices if they suck in and transfer excessively high power than your device can cope with. That’s mainly because of the loopholes in manufacturing. All manufacturers don’t keep the standards in mind and as a result produce faulty cables.

In the recent years, manufacturers have halted the production of computers with a RS-232 port which was quite common in old computers. Now the only way to connect RS-232 devices with computers is by using computer adapters which connect such devices to USB ports. Thus, a USB to RS-232 adapter is required to make the connection.
More often than not, users face issues while connecting their RS-232 device with the computer, in spite of using correct computer adapters. In this blog, we will discuss the most common issues regarding the same.
Driver Issues
Getting the proper driver installed to connect your RS-232 device to the computer is essential to form a seamless connection. It’s one of the most common issues identified as users face problems while getting the suitable driver to be installed.
Solution: Users must make a note that the driver should sync to the chip inside the cable and not the manufacturer (of the cable). It is better that you choose cables by manufacturers that use certified driver available with Windows update. To solve issues with your computer adaptercable, you will require having an internet connection to install the driver which cannot be automatically installed. Windows Device Manager also contains the information regarding your Cable’s chip sometimes. So, you can also locate it and download the correct driver and version of Windows.
Hardware Issues
The hardware, as for every other electronic device, of these cables can eventually fail with usage.
Solution: It is best to consider buying computer adapters of higher quality, manufactured by trusted cable companies. Cables manufactured by these companies last longer, though eventually you will require a replacement. The running time depends on the workload that the RS-232 to USB cable goes through. A low quality cable will come apart in a short period of time, sometimes even within a day of usage. So the solution ultimately is not to compromise with the hardware quality of any of your computer components, whether internal or external.
Performance Issues
USB uses a shared data bus i.e. the data is wrapped up and transferred in form of packets. One drawback that arises from using USB to RS-232 cables is that the data transfer time which was almost insignificant when computers had RS-232 ports. This data transfer time is lags in performance when huge files are being transferred.
Solution: Though there isn’t any hard and fast solution which can get rid of the transfer time, it can be reduced to some level. The driver of the FTDI chip in your computer adapter can help in reducing this time. This can be done by accessing the Latency Timer field from the Windows device manager. Keep the setting at ‘1’, for optimal results.
Conclusion
Even though new developments in the technology sector are considering USB ports for external devices which typically used to be manufactured with RS-232 ports, it would take a long time for the total transition. Most of the quality data log devices stick to RS-232 which implies that you would be required to continue using such connections. The issues addressed in the blog should be helpful to troubleshoot most of the everyday issues you might come across while deploying such computer adapters.
When Apple unveiled its latest MacBook Pro, the authorities announced that the device would just use USB Type C port for transferring data and powering it. Since that day, USB Type C has gained popularity and has set an example for other USB cable standards. So what exactly is USB C cable and what makes it better than other USB cables? Let’s check it out: Introduction to USB Type C CableType C is the latest USB connector which is double sided and has 24 pins. As it is a reversible USB, you do not have to fiddle with it in order to decide which side should be plugged in. This was a huge problem with Type-A connector port. Type C looks just a little different from other cables but there is a huge improvement with its standards. What Makes USB Type C a better choice?Although most devices use USB Type A cables, it comes across as quite bulky and large. Moreover, as these USB cables are used for desktops, they cannot be used with sleek and modern devices like cameras, laptops, smart phones and tablets. In order to bridge this gap, USB Micro, Mini and Type B were introduced. However, using such cables is not advisable if you have latest and modernized devices. USB Type-C is fast, high powered and small. Moreover, it works with anything if you have the right kind of adapter. The DrawbacksThere is no doubt about the fact that the utility and popularity of USB Type C cables will go up in the near future. But the cables are still in their budding stage and there are certain dangers and confusions which should be avoided. As USB C refers more to the style of connector it is rather than its internal specifications, the buyers might be in for a surprise when they find out that it isn’t at fast as they thought it would be. USB-C Gen 1 products make use of USB 3.0 technology, having a speed of 5Gbps, whereas USB-C Gen 2 makes use of USB 3.1 technology providing you with a speed of 10Gbps. USB Cables can prove to be overwhelming sometimes because even if they look similar, there are several factors and variables which affect their capabilities. In order to power a device, one has to check out if the cable supports USB Power Delivery. For HDMI, DisplayPort and MHL videos, you might require USB-C cable having Alternative-Mode functionality. The Future of USB Type C cablesAlthough there will be a gradual enforcement of standard features for these cables in the future, you must go through all the details before making a purchase. USB Type C was introduced in the August 2014 and it is the latest connector which is used for syncing data and charging. It makes use of 24 pin reversible plug connector. So it’s easy to plug in devices and there is no need to get confused as to which side should be up. As people have started using USB Type C a lot, here are some insights about the cable and the ways in which you can use it. Compatibility with all the devices
Some of the majorly used USB cables are Type A, B, microB and miniB. USB Type C can replace all these USB cables, which makes it a universal medium to charge and manage your devices. Hence, you do not need different USBs for different tasks. Get a USB Type C cable and your work is done. Power to charge laptops With the help of USB Type B, you can charge devices having a higher power such as laptops. This is because it has been designed to provide a significant amount of power for charging electronic devices. Fast charging facility Type C enables you to charge your devices faster if your device and charger are compatible to each other. This is known as Power Delivery. You are sure to love this feature. Transfers data rapidlyType C cables can support USB2 as well as the faster USB3 data at the speed of 10Gbps. There are 2 generations of USB 3; namely, USB 3.1 Gen 1 and USB 3.1 Gen 2. Gen 1 is up to 5Gbps of data making it 10 times faster than USB 2.0 and Gen 2 is up to 10Gbps making it 20 times faster than USB 2.0. Supports additional data Through USB Type C, you can remotely monitor the device battery if your device is compatible with such a feature. Things to keep in mind while buying Type C Cables When you go for buying USB Cables, you must remember that there are two levels of power. You can buy either a 3A (60W) or 5A (100W) Type-C cable depending on the speed and power of what you need to charge. Make sure you buy the right cable as lower power means slow charging. There are several duplicate Type C cables available in the market so check its authenticity properly before you purchase them. The Future of Type C Chargers Power delivery specifications latest version has made the marking of power supply extremely easy for the end user. Power Delivery helps the device and charger to decide the amount of current that is available for charging. The latest PD version also supports authentication of chargers. This helps the devices to check whether they are being charged by using a genuine charger. Let’s wait and watch as to how the charger market takes it, but it is sure to bring some drastic changes.
